It can't show individual posts but it will shove a topic to the front again if it keeps getting posts, the gadget reads the RSS output from the forum so I can't make it read anymore than the forum outputs.

Not possible. Well actually, it would be possible, but it would require extensive work within IPB to generate per-user RSS feeds, and then the ability to enter your username into the gadget. Something that would require both lots of work and maintenance, and someone who knows how to actually do all that, since it would require a fair bit of coding to do.

Simple answer: no, I'm afraid.
